Social Innovation Expert to Launch UE’s Changemaker Challenge Events

Posted: Friday, October 14, 2016

The Institute for Global Enterprise at the University of Evansville will kick off the second wave of the Changemaker Challenge competitions during Social Innovation Week October 17-21. Events during this week are designed to inspire innovation and entrepreneurship that create positive social change.

Professor Scott Sherman, founder and director of the award-winning Transformative Action Institute, will speak at the launch events. He will assist with launching the 2017 Collegiate and High School Changemaker Challenge competitions by guiding students while inspiring creativity and encouraging new approaches to address challenges in the community.

UE will host two Changemaker Challenge competitions, planned for February 2017, for young people to propose innovative solutions to pressing challenges in our community and beyond. The collegiate competition will provide a chance for UE students to pitch their ideas and compete for seed funding to help make their ideas a reality. The high school event will be open to area high schools and students will compete for four-year full-tuition scholarships to attend UE.

Sherman’s social innovation curriculum has been taught at more than 30 universities across the world including Yale, Princeton, Cornell, New York University, UCLA, Johns Hopkins, and UC Berkeley. Both Echoing Green and Ashoka University have recognized the Transformative Action Institute as a key innovator in social entrepreneurship education. Sherman has worked on nonviolence and social justice projects from war-torn Sri Lanka to America’s inner cities

Thursday, October 20
Noon-1:00 p.m., Carver Community Center at 400 SE 8th Street, Evansville

Carver Community Center Alternative Energy Celebration

UE students worked with Carver Community Center to obtain a $90,580 grant to install solar panels and LED bulbs, saving the Center on its energy bills. Come celebrate with these Changemakers and hear how it happened.
